    I was football mad as a kid and obviously devoted to Barnsley, but that didn’t stop me ranking other clubs in order of preference.

    Man City over Utd, Everton over Liverpool, Spurs over Arsenal etc. My old firm team was and still is Rangers. I’m a committed atheist so no religious element involved at all. It’s just nice to have an interest in the outcome of the old firm games which are usually highly entertaining and I really don’t understand why it should be seen as any indicator of any sinister prejudice to express a preference.
